Preparation Before Installation

Prior to commencing the installation, several preparatory steps are recommended to ensure a smooth and safe process. These steps include unboxing inspection, vehicle preparation, and selecting an appropriate mounting location.

Unboxing and Component Verification

Upon receiving a Nilight light bar, the first step is a thorough unboxing inspection. The documentation indicates that packages typically include mounting brackets, a specialized wiring harness, the LED light bar itself, a warranty card, and potentially discount cards or additional gifts. It is crucial to verify the presence of all listed components. The documentation notes that some kits may not include a wiring harness or all necessary external fittings, in which case these may need to be purchased separately. A combo kit, containing the light bar and wiring, is presented as a more affordable option.

Vehicle Preparation

Vehicle preparation involves ensuring the vehicle is in a safe and ready condition for the installation. The engine must be turned off, and both the positive and negative terminals of the battery should be disconnected, removing the ground terminal first. If the vehicle has been recently operated, it is advisable to allow it to cool down before beginning the installation. The installation should be performed in a safe environment.

Selecting a Mounting Location

Choosing the correct mounting location is critical for optimal performance. The documentation suggests several potential locations, including the roof of the vehicle, the front bumper, or the intake grille. For off-road driving, mounting the light bar on the front bumper is recommended to maximize visibility. The selected location should not obstruct essential vehicle components. The documentation also states that shorter light bars can be installed on the car at the intake grille. The front and center of the vehicle, or the location of the bumper bars, are also presented as easier installation points.

Wiring the Light Bar

Proper wiring is essential for the safe and effective operation of the light bar. The documentation emphasizes the importance of using a relay, particularly for high-powered LED or halogen bulbs, to prevent potential damage to the vehicle’s wiring.

The Role of a Relay

A relay is an electrical device that uses a low-power signal to control a high-power device. Without a relay, a high-powered light bar could draw excessive current, potentially damaging the vehicle’s electrical system.

Wiring Harness Connection

The light bar should be wired using a relay wiring harness, which typically includes connections for the battery, a switch, and the light bar itself. The wiring harness should be routed along a concealed path, secured with zip ties or adhesive clips to protect it from damage. All connections must be secure and properly insulated.

Wiring Route Options

Two potential wiring routes are suggested: tucking the wiring underneath the dashboard or running it along the vehicle’s frame. If running the wiring along the frame, ample insulation tape should be used to prevent abrasion. The documentation advises consulting the vehicle’s owner’s manual if a dedicated wiring harness for the light bar is not readily available.

Post-Installation Testing and Considerations

After completing the mounting and wiring, thorough testing is crucial to verify the installation’s success.

Testing Functionality

With the vehicle turned on, the light bar’s functionality should be tested. The brightness should be checked, and adjustments to the mounting brackets or wiring may be necessary to achieve optimal illumination. A test drive at night is recommended to assess the light bar’s performance in real-world conditions.

Wiring Security

The documentation stresses the importance of securing the wiring to prevent damage. Zip ties and adhesive clips are recommended for keeping the wiring harness out of sight and protected.
